Subtropical Storm Ana has formed

The first storm of the 2021 Atlantic Hurricane Season has formed.


Subtropical Storm Ana formed this morning. The storm has maximum sustained winds are near 75 km/h with higher gusts.


The storm poses no threat to Canada or the United States.


There is a Tropical Storm Watch in effect for Bermuda. Tropical storm conditions are possible on Bermuda today.


The storm is expected to weaken through tonight and Sunday before dissipating in a couple of days.


The Atlantic Hurricane Season runs from June 1 to November 30.
